Welcome to my website. I am a Christian philosopher in the analytic tradition. My primary philosophical interests are epistemology, metaphysics, and philosophy of religion. My current areas of research and writing are natural theology, religious epistemology, and postmortem survival.

I have taught at Calvin College, Saint Michael's College, and the University of Hartford. I'm presently a full-time lecturer and coordinator of the Religious Studies program at San Francisco State University.  Click here to view my SFSU profile page.
